That the business to the south (Cullinan Rigging) of the Subject Property desires to expand <br />their business operation and is negotiating a purchase agreement with the Permittee for the <br />acquisition of 2.5 acres of the Subject Property to accommodate a building expansion. <br />10. That the Permittee wants to work with their neighbor to accommodate their needs but <br />expressed a concern that if they reduce their lot size by 2.5 acres, it may impact their <br />projected need for outside storage. <br />11. That the Permittee desires to keep their same allowable square footage for outside storage, <br />even if the Subject Property is reduced in size as part of an Administrative Subdivision. <br />12. That the Building size on the Subject Property is not changing and is still under allowed <br />coverage. <br />13. That the Permittee appeared before the Planning Commission on November 5, 2020 for a <br />public hearing and that said public hearing was properly advertised and that the minutes of <br />said public hearing are hereby incorporated by reference. <br />FINDINGS OF FACT <br />1.
